Cat: so, for context, we’re a plural system; a group of multiple people living in the same brain. We’re wondering if there’s any other systems on Lemmy at the moment. Also could be considered an AMA for those interested.

Frequently Asked Questions:

-No, you don’t need trauma or a disorder to be plural, though there’s a fair bit of overlap. In our case, Just intentionally hacked her brain to run multiple people.

-We’re people, not personalities for a single person.

-The idea of the “evil headmate” is flatly incorrect.

-Sometimes there’s headmates patterned on fictional characters or real people, referred to as Fictives or Factives respectively.
